Ingredients

INGREDIENTS

  • 1 sheet puff pastry, thawed
  • 1 cup smoked Gouda cheese, shredded
  • 1 tablespoon fresh chives,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Flour for dusting

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. On a lightly floured surface, roll out the puff pastry sheet to smooth out any creases.
  3. Cut the pastry into strips, about 1 inch wide.
  4. In a bowl, combine the shredded smoked Gouda cheese, chives, parsley, salt, and pepper.
  5. Place a small amount of the cheese mixture along one edge of each pastry strip.
  6. Fold the pastry over to encase the cheese mixture, pressing the edges to seal. Twist each strip gently to create a spiral shape.
  7. Brush each twist with the beaten egg to give them a golden color while baking.
  8. Arrange the twists on the prepared baking sheet, leaving space between each one.
  9. Bake in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es, or until golden brown and puffed up.
  10. Remove from the oven and let cool slightly before serving.

Notes

Tip: For a touch of heat, add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the cheese mixture!

For variations, try different cheese like aged cheddar or fontina for a unique taste. You can also experiment with herbs such as thyme or rosemary for a different flavor profile.

Be cautious not to overfill the pastry with cheese, as it can ooze out while baking. Ensure the edges are well sealed for the best results.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ator and reheat in the oven for a few minutes to regain their crispness.
